Understanding Aviation Accident Classifications

Aviation incident classifications help distinguish between types of events and their implications for safety analysis. These categories often inform how investigations proceed and how the public interprets outcomes. Understanding basic definitions improves clarity when discussing high-profile cases.

Controlled Flight Into Terrain (CFIT)

CFIT occurs when an airworthy aircraft is inadvertently flown into terrain, obstacles, or water. This category often involves instrument or visual misjudgment, navigation error, or environmental factors. Many high-profile passenger and private accidents fall under this classification due to its relevance to pilot decision-making and technology use.

Loss of Control In-flight (LOC-I)

LOC-I covers situations where an aircraft departs from stable flight due to aerodynamic, system, or human factors. It is a leading cause in general aviation and has drawn attention in both regulatory and media discussions. Recognizing this classification helps contextualize accident reports that emphasize training, procedures, and aircraft design.

Midair Collision and Runway Incursion

Midair collisions, though rare, can involve military or civil aircraft and often prompt significant safety reforms. Runway incursions relate to ground operations but sometimes escalate to more severe outcomes. When public figures are involved, these categories clarify that outcomes depend on multiple interacting factors, including airspace management and situational awareness.

Contextual Factors and Preventive Measures

Beyond individual incidents, broader factors influence trends and outcomes in general aviation. Historical shifts in regulation, technology, and training continue to shape risk profiles. Examining these elements clarifies why certain patterns have evolved and how public understanding should adapt.

Regulation and Certification Changes

Over decades, aviation authorities have introduced requirements for equipment, maintenance, and pilot certification. These changes reflect lessons learned from past accidents, though implementation varies across regions and aircraft categories. Tracking these shifts helps explain improvements in safety metrics over time.

Technology and Data Analysis

Advances in flight data recording, weather radar, and communication systems have reduced certain error modes. However, adoption lag in private and older fleets remains a challenge. Understanding technological context supports more nuanced discussions about accountability and prevention.

Pilot Training and Decision-Making

Training standards, recurrent checks, and scenario-based education influence how pilots respond to emerging threats. In many investigated incidents, gaps in risk assessment or procedural adherence contribute to outcomes. Highlighting training importance aligns with long-term safety goals rather than attributing outcomes to single factors.
